New Forest Wildlife Park opens new enclosure for Eurasian Lynx sisters
25th Mar 2026
New Forest Wildlife Park has opened a new enclosure for its two resident Eurasian lynx, Tora and Inga, replacing a habitat believed to have been in use since before the park came under its current ownership in 1998.

Celebration at New Forest Wildlife Park as the UK's only breeding pair of smooth-coated otters welcome cubs
9th Feb 2026
In a conservation victory for one of the world's most threatened otter species, New Forest Wildlife Park has announced the birth of two male smooth-coated otter cubs from the only successfully breeding pair in the United Kingdom.

Three's Company: How Tibiri, Acari, and Meamu became the park's happy otter trio
29th Jan 2026
Three lone females who each needed companionship have now formed their own little family group. Meet Tibiri, Acari, and Meamu, three individuals with distinct personalities who've come together in a way that's very important for giant otter welfare.
